Achieving Sweeping: Techniques for a Spotless Home

Sweeping might appear like a simple chore, but mastering the art of sweeping can truly transform your home cleaning routine. A skilled sweeper knows that thoroughly swept floor is the foundation of a sparkling atmosphere.

To begin with, choose the right tool. A sturdy broom with stiff bristles is perfect for tile floors, while a softer bristle broom is better for carpets and rugs.

, Then, pay heed to your sweeping technique. Commence in one corner and work systematically across the floor, overlapping every stroke. Don't forget to gather near baseboards and corners where dust and debris tend to accumulate.

Ultimately, don't dismiss the importance of disposal your dustpan regularly. A full dustpan impedes your sweeping progress and can even spread dirt around.

Effective Manual Sweeping Strategies

Achieving a spotless sweep requires more than just aimless motions. A strategic approach to manual sweeping can noticeably improve the outcome. First, evaluate the area to be swept, pinpointing any dense debris that requires prioritization. Then, employ a smooth sweeping motion, blending your strokes to ensure complete coverage. Don't forget to move dust and debris toward a central area, making it more convenient to collect and dispose of later.

  • Regularly service your broom to confirm optimal performance.
  • Adapt your sweeping technique based on the floor being swept, using a lighter touch on fragile surfaces.
  • Refine consistent sweeping motions to maximize efficiency and achieve a superior clean.
